On Tue, Jul 05, 2016 at 11:50:08AM +0800, Zhiyong Tao wrote:
> The commit adds the device tree binding documentation for the mediatek
> auxadc found on Mediatek MT2701.
> Thermal gets auxadc sample data by iio device.
> So the commit changes auxadc device tree binding documentation from
> /soc/mediatek/auxadc.txt to /iio/adc/mt65xx_auxadc.txt.
>
> Signed-off-by: Zhiyong Tao <zhiyong.tao-NuS5LvNUpcJWk0Htik3J/w@public.gmane.org>
> ---
> .../devicetree/bindings/iio/adc/mt65xx_auxadc.txt | 27 ++++++++++++++++++++
> .../devicetree/bindings/soc/mediatek/auxadc.txt | 21 ---------------
> 2 files changed, 27 insertions(+), 21 deletions(-)
> create mode 100644 Documentation/devicetree/bindings/iio/adc/mt65xx_auxadc.txt
> delete mode 100644 Documentation/devicetree/bindings/soc/mediatek/auxadc.txt
Next time, use the git-format-patch -M option to send so only the
changes have to be reviewed.

> +* Mediatek AUXADC - Analog to Digital Converter on Mediatek mobile soc (mt65xx/mt81xx/mt27xx)
> +===============
> +
> +The Auxiliary Analog/Digital Converter (AUXADC) is an ADC found
> +in some Mediatek SoCs which among other things measures the temperatures
> +in the SoC. It can be used directly with register accesses, but it is also
> +used by thermal controller which reads the temperatures from the AUXADC
> +directly via its own bus interface. See
> +Documentation/devicetree/bindings/thermal/mediatek-thermal.txt
> +for the Thermal Controller which holds a phandle to the AUXADC.
> +
> +Required properties:
> + - compatible: "mediatek,mt2701-auxadc" or "mediatek,mt8173-auxadc"
> + - reg: Address range of the AUXADC unit.
> + - clocks: Should contain a clock specifier for each entry in clock-names
> + - clock-names: Should contain "main".
> + - io-channel-cells: Should be 1, see ../iio-bindings.txt
Should be #io-channel-cells
> +
> +Example:
> +
> +auxadc: auxadc@11001000 {
Should be adc@...
> + compatible = "mediatek,mt2701-auxadc";
> + reg = <0 0x11001000 0 0x1000>;
> + clocks = <&pericfg CLK_PERI_AUXADC>;
> + clock-names = "main";
> + #io-channel-cells = <1>;
> +};
